JUDGMENT

ANSAH, JSC

This is an appeal against the judgment of the Court of Appeal (Civil Division), Cape Coast, dated 27th June 2017, coram: C J Honyenuga, (presiding): Alhaji Saeed Kwaku Gyan and G. S. Suurbareh JJA. The first Plaintiff-Respondent hereinafter called the respondent, is the occupant of the Apowa Stool and the second, the head of the Asamankama Stool Family of Apowa; the defendant is the appellant herein. The land in dispute called Sankoba, measured about 559.17 acres, and was acquired by J.F. Scheck at an auction in 1896, for farming purposes. Subsequently, J.F. Scheck and his successors held title to the land and had exclusive possession without any let or hindrance from anybody. All those who farmed the land did so with the permission of Scheck’s successors. However, in recent times the defendant appellant and his predecessors in title granted a greater part of the land to people for residential and commercial purposes.
